Obstacles to interactivity
This is my site Written by Paul Evans on May 11, 2009 – 12:46 pm

Tim Davies has written a post about the kind of obstacles that get in the way of organisations in promoting interactivity. He has then spun it out into a Wiki.

It’s quite a brilliant idea of Tim’s and I’ve written about it here on the Local Democracy blog. My shorter version of a long post is this:

Often, the minor technical obstacles mask a wider small-p political obstructionism to the promotion of a more interactive form of government.
